fullMETAL Posted November 17, 2011 Share Posted November 17, 2011 I gotta say, I think you worked WAAAAAY too hard on this, LT. You could try the equivalent of what I do--I make my stroke into a dotted one (with no spacing), make it only inside-path, then Inner Bevel:Down on it. It works almost perfectly as a duplicate for the "scallop" tooling used by most of the current beltmakers on their leather.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

liontamer Posted November 19, 2011 Author Share Posted November 19, 2011 I gotta say, I think you worked WAAAAAY too hard on this, LT. You could try the equivalent of what I do--I make my stroke into a dotted one (with no spacing), make it only inside-path, then Inner Bevel:Down on it. It works almost perfectly as a duplicate for the "scallop" tooling used by most of the current beltmakers on their leather. Thanks for the tip. I played with it a bit tonight and noticed a few issues preventing me from doing that. One is that aside from the default dashed line (dashes too long and skinny to be useful), I can't seem to get the connecting line out of any attempts I make to have anything but a straight line (ruins the bevel). The second, is that ppx2 only seems to allow upward bevels, so I can't carve inward, only outward. I'll keep looking though to see what I can find as that is something I'll need for all belts going forward. And time-wise yes I did work too hard, but it was fun and I learned a lot.
